Stuburt Helium HE shoes

Immediately comfortable and by the end of the first round they'd lost that “new shoe” feeling. Nice and roomy and extremely stable to swing in. Add in the stylish green/white/black colouring and you've got a good shoe at a good price.

These full-grain leather shoes are packed with performance features such as waterproof, breathable DriBack membranes, heel grips to prevent slippage, a progressive tightening system for just the right fit, and dual forefoot flex channels to help the shoe move more with your foot as you walk and swing.
